Block

#21,804,796
Block Number
21,804,796 @ 05/30/2025, 03:53:00
Status
Finalized
ID
0x014cb6fc11907faeaf107c8ae002c167de1cf3f39a29a4a9af3e5bd07495cad7
Transactions
Gas Used
16571064/40000000 (41.43% Used)
Total Score
2,129,531,750 (+98)
Rewards
72.87 VTHO